SUMMARY
STUDY ON PARA-NITROPHENOL DECOMPOSITION USING TiO, COATED GAC
The ultimate goal of this research is to combine the adsorptive properties of activated carbon
with the oxidative properties of titanium dioxide, aphotocatalyst, i n order to prepare a regenerated
photocatalytic-adsorptive material. The promise is that the,activated carbon, coated with TiO,,
would capture the organic components owing to the conventional adsorption. When the adsorptive
capacity of carbon becomes exhausted, it can be in situ regenerated by using the W lamps for
activating the photocatalyst. This paper presents the comparative results of the adsorptive
oxidative capacities of two types of commercially available activated carbon with loadings of 5 and
10% of TiO, (wlw).
